Sihayo Gold restarts drilling at Tambang Tinggi prospect
Tuesday, February 15 2011 - 02:38 AM WIB
The current drilling program is following up on scout drilling undertaken in 2005. Scout drilling intersected 125 m @ 1.4 g/t Au from surface, including 25m @ 4.58 g/t Au from 31m in what is interpreted to be the phyllic alteration zone of a Porphyry Cu‐Au system, the company said.
The current program is designed to potentially deliver the Company?s second JORC-compliant gold resource to compliment the flagship Sihayo Pungkut Gold Project (10.7 Mt @ 2.9 g/t Au for 1.01 million oz).
Detailed surface work through the Tambang Tinggi Region is defining significant zones of gold and copper mineralisation.
A soil sampling program has defined an area of approximately 2.5km by 0.6km containing anomalous gold and copper. A detailed rock chip sampling program has returned a number of high grade gold, copper and silver results, with 20% of samples returning >1 g/t Au and a best sample of 62 g/t Au. In addition, 7% of samples returned >30 g/t Ag with a best sample of 490 g/t Ag and 6% of samples returned >0.5% Cu with a best sample of 5.03% Cu, it said. (alex)
